Output 90ec25b6ed788ea71972de0fcd7a8385a6fbf4c927a35d793c809917171d619e:7

value
480820000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f63649f3ac7142eda96e88a65a68707ffed37e91 OP_EQUAL
address
3Q8sBnqiTLo3B1JME54xQwksVFaeoN2VdB
transaction
90ec25b6ed788ea71972de0fcd7a8385a6fbf4c927a35d793c809917171d619e
spent
true